Understanding the Average Cost of Built In Entertainment Centers

The average cost of a built-in entertainment center is around $2,500 to $5,000, but this can vary depending on the size, materials, and features you want. For example, a larger entertainment center made from high-quality materials such as solid wood can cost upwards of $10,000. On the other hand, a smaller entertainment center made from engineered wood or laminate can cost under $1,000.

Factors That Affect the Cost of Built In Entertainment Centers

Several factors can affect the cost of a built-in entertainment center:

  • Size: The larger the entertainment center, the more materials and labor will be required.
  • Materials: High-quality materials such as solid wood will cost more than engineered wood or laminate.
  • Features: Additional features such as lighting, shelving, and cabinets will increase the cost.
  • Installation: The cost of installation will vary depending on the complexity of the project and the contractor’s fees.

Pros and Cons of Average Cost of Built In Entertainment Centers

Pros:

  • Built-in entertainment centers can add value to your home.
  • They provide a custom look and feel that can’t be achieved with a pre-made unit.
  • They can be designed to fit your specific needs and preferences.

Cons:

  • Built-in entertainment centers can be expensive.
  • The installation process can be time-consuming and disruptive.
  • They may not be as flexible as a pre-made unit if you decide to change the layout of your room.

Question and Answer / FAQs

Q: What materials are best for a built-in entertainment center?

A: High-quality materials such as solid wood are best for a built-in entertainment center because they are durable and long-lasting. However, engineered wood or laminate can be a more affordable option.

Q: How long does it take to install a built-in entertainment center?

A: The installation process can vary depending on the complexity of the project and the contractor’s availability. However, it can take anywhere from a few days to a few weeks.

Q: Can I install a built-in entertainment center myself?

A: It is possible to install a built-in entertainment center yourself, but it is a complex and time-consuming process that requires specialized tools and skills. It is recommended to hire a professional contractor for the best results.
